Identifying Visual Signs of Hail Damage on Asphalt Shingles
Asphalt shingles display specific visual indicators when struck by hail during storms. The most common signs of hail damage on shingles include circular dents or bruises where the impact compressed the protective layers. These marks often feel soft to the touch and may show loss of granules, exposing the black asphalt roof deck underneath as dark spots across the surface of the roof. Larger hailstones can create more obvious indentations, while smaller stones leave subtle bruising that becomes harder to detect from ground level.
Roof hail damage identification requires understanding how impact patterns differ from normal wear. Hail creates a random distribution of damage across the roof’s surface, with bruises and exposed areas appearing in irregular patterns rather than concentrated in specific zones. Natural aging produces uniform deterioration along roof edges, valleys, and south-facing slopes where sun exposure accelerates breakdown. When examining hail damage on a roof’s surfaces, look for fresh granule loss with distinct boundaries around impact sites, whereas aging shows gradual granule wear with smooth transitions between affected and unaffected areas.
What Hail Damage Looks Like on Metal, Tile, and Wood Roofing
Metal roofing displays hail damage differently than asphalt materials, with visible dents and dings appearing across panel surfaces after significant storms. The appearance of these impacts varies based on the gauge thickness and coating type protecting the metal. Thinner gauge panels show more pronounced denting from smaller hailstones, while thicker commercial-grade metal resists minor impacts. Painted or coated finishes may crack or chip around impact points, exposing bare metal beneath and creating potential rust sites if left unaddressed during a hail damage roof inspection.
Clay and concrete tile roofs reveal storm damage through cracked, chipped, or completely displaced tiles that shift from their original positions. Hailstones striking tile surfaces create fracture lines that may not break completely through but compromise the tile’s water-shedding capability. Wood shake roofing shows split or fractured sections where hail impact exceeded the material’s flexibility, particularly on older installations where weathering has reduced resilience. Understanding what hail damage looks like on different roofing materials helps property owners recognize when a professional assessment becomes necessary to prevent leaks and structural deterioration.
Inspecting Roof Components Beyond the Main Surface
Roof hail damage identification extends beyond examining shingles to include metal components that often reveal clearer evidence of storm activity. Gutters, downspouts, and metal vents typically display visible dents and dings that confirm hail impact occurred across the property. These fixtures consist of softer metals than roofing materials, making them more susceptible to showing obvious marks from hailstones. Flashing around chimneys, skylights, and roof gaps frequently exhibits similar damage patterns that correlate directly with potential shingle compromise in surrounding areas.
Air conditioning units sitting at ground level or on rooftop platforms show clear dimpling on their metal casings and fan guards after significant storms. Satellite dishes, outdoor light fixtures, and aluminum window sills all serve as reliable indicators of hail size and storm severity. These accessible components allow property owners to assess impact evidence without climbing onto the roof, helping determine whether afull roof inspection becomes necessary to evaluate the full scale of potential issues.
Close-Up Details That Distinguish Hail Damage From Other Roof Problems
Hail bruises on asphalt shingles create distinct characteristics that separate them from other common roofing problems when examined closely. These impact marks typically appear as circular or oblong indentations with soft, compressed centers where the granule layer was forced into the underlying mat. Blistering occurs when trapped moisture or gases expand beneath the shingle surface, creating raised bubbles with hard edges rather than depressed areas. Cracking from age produces linear splits following shingle patterns or stress points, while normal weathering causes gradual, uniform granule loss without the concentrated circular pattern that hail creates during roof hail damage identification.
Understanding the difference between hail damage and mechanical damage requires examining impact characteristics and the surrounding context. Foot traffic produces scuff marks with directional smearing of granules and damage concentrated along typical walking paths near roof access points and equipment. Fallen branches create linear scrapes or gouges with displaced shingles showing directional force patterns.
Installation defects appear as systematic problems affecting multiple shingles in similar ways, such as lifted corners or exposed nail heads in regular patterns. Hail impact leaves a random distribution across exposed roof planes with consistent circular bruising shapes, helping property owners recognize legitimate storm damage when learning how to spot hail damage on the surface of a roof during the inspection.
Safe Methods for Conducting Your Own Preliminary Roof Inspection
Property owners can perform effective ground-level assessments using binoculars to examine roofing surfaces for visible signs of hail damage on shingles without risking personal injury or causing additional damage to compromised materials. Standing at various angles around the property allows inspection of different roof planes, focusing on areas where sunlight creates shadows that highlight dents and missing granules.
This approach provides a safe preliminary evaluation while documenting concerns that may warrant professional assessment. Examining accessible components like gutters and downspouts from the ground reveals displaced granules and denting that correlate with potential roof damage.
When closer examination becomes necessary for thorough roof hail damage identification, proper ladder placement against stable surfaces, and securing the base, prevent accidents during access. Taking photographs or video footage from roof level documents damage patterns for insurance claims without requiring extensive walking across potentially weakened shingles. A smartphone camera with zoom capability captures detailed images of suspected impact sites, bruising patterns, and granule loss. Limiting time on the roof and avoiding walking on steep slopes or wet surfaces reduces risk while gathering evidence needed to determine whether professional inspection services should evaluate the full extent of storm damage across the entire roofing system.
Taking Action After Discovering Potential Hail Damage
Professional roof inspection becomes essential once property owners identify potential storm damage through preliminary observation. Certified roofing contractors possess the expertise and equipment to conduct full inspections that can reveal the full extent of damage across all roofing components. These professionals document findings with detailed reports, measurements, and photographic evidence that insurance companies require when processing claims.
A thorough assessment examines not only visible surface damage but also underlying structural concerns that might compromise the roof’s performance over time, including damaged roof decking, compromised underlayment, and weakened fastener connections that homeowners cannot detect during basic visual checks.
Documenting findings before contacting insurance adjusters strengthens the claims process by establishing a clear record of damage immediately following a storm. Taking dated photographs from multiple angles captures the condition of shingles, metal components, and surrounding property elements that show consistent impact patterns. Written notes describing the location, size, and quantity of damaged areas supplement visual documentation. Property owners should photograph soft metals like gutters and vents that display obvious denting, which corroborates damage to less visible roofing materials. This preparation allows contractors and adjusters to verify conditions efficiently, expediting the approval process for necessary repairs that protect structural integrity.
